Here are a few helpful resources in Australia, available to support your needs.

​Lifeline Australia
In times of a crisis you can speak to crisis support. Service available 24 hours a day, 7 days a week.
Lifeline Australia - 13 11 14 - Crisis Support. Suicide Prevention.  
​
Kids Helpline
1800 55 1800
Available 24/7
Visit kidshelpline.com.au
Kids Helpline | Phone Counselling Service | 1800 55 1800

1800 Respect
National domestic, family and sexual violence counselling, information and support service. 
1800 737 732

Available 24/7
Visit 1800respect.org.au

Griefline
https://griefline.org.au
Phone support sessions are secure and confidential and available to adults aged 18 years and over. Call our toll-free helpline between the hours of 8am and 8pm Monday to Friday (AEST), or​Book a call at a time that suits you.

Books
Here you will find a list of books that you may enjoy or find useful along your journey.
  1. Switch On Your Brain: The Key to Peak Happiness, Thinking, and Health Paperback – 4 August 2015 by Dr. Caroline Leaf 
  2. The Body Keeps the Score: Mind, Brain and Body in the Transformation of Trauma Paperback – Import, 1 December 2015 by Bessel Van Der Kolk (Author)​
  3. Family Ties That Bind: A Self-help Guide to Change through Family of Origin Therapy 4ed Paperback – 15 April 2011 by Ronald W Richardson
  4. Five Love Languages Revised Edition: The Secret to Love That Lasts Paperback – 15 June 2015 by Gary Chapman (Author)
  5. Untangled - Understanding teenager daughters by Lisa Damour
  6. The Mindful Guide to Conflict Resolution - by Rosalie Puiman - How to handle difficult situations, conversations and personalities
  7. Chicken Soup for the Soul - Think Positive Preteens by Amy Newmark
  8. Everyday Resilience by Michelle Mitchell - Helping kids handle friendship drama, academic pressure and the self-doubt of growing up
  9. What to Do When You Worry Too Much: A Kid's Guide to Overcoming Anxiety
    Part of: What-to-Do Guides for Kids (18 books) by Dawn Huebner and Bonnie Matthews | 30 December 2005
  10. The Memory Box: A Book about Grief: by Joanna Rowland (Author), Thea Baker (Illustrator)
  11. It Will be Okay: Trusting God Through Fear and Change (Little Seed & Little Fox) by Lysa TerKeurst  (Author)
  12. The Invisible String by Patrice Karst
  13. The 7 Habits of Highly Effective Teens by Sean Covey
  14. In My Heart by Jo Witek
  15. Thinking For A Change by John C. Maxwell
  16. Living with IT - by Bev Aisbett - a survivor's guide to overcoming panic an anxiety
